Output 24df40401366a92bdfe415ef1133c3cccae2de6d9230787f7c28f0bad8e9b85e:4

value
16593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 929fb16d88550e5b77c56ea1ee61d82de1846e27 OP_EQUAL
address
3F4HtDkAnQop3NsNpHm3bfQE6m6MdKiqe2
transaction
24df40401366a92bdfe415ef1133c3cccae2de6d9230787f7c28f0bad8e9b85e
confirmations
40105
spent
true